Hidden Disabilities Sunflower

Powerhouse has adopted the Hidden Disabilities SunflowerExternal link icon to help support and raise awareness of those living with a hidden disability. Free lanyards and wristbands are available from the cloaking desk.

Wheelchair Access

Companion Card

The museum is an affiliate of the NSW Government’s Department of Ageing, Disability and Home Care’s Companion Card programExternal link icon. Support persons receive free entry to paid exhibitions and programs when accompanying a Companion Card holder.

Sydney Observatory has adopted the Hidden Disabilities SunflowerExternal link icon to help support and raise awareness of those living with a hidden disability.

Wheelchair Access

Companion Card

The museum is an affiliate of the NSW Government’s Department of Ageing, Disability and Home Care’s Companion Card programExternal link icon. Support persons receive free entry to paid exhibitions and programs when accompanying a Companion Card holder.
